BHA (beta hydroxy acid) is good for pores since it's an antibacterial that goes into the pore to clean it out and prevent blackheads. Paula's Choice 2% or 1%, Vichy's Normaderm 4% (from canada), and Trish McEvoy's BHA pads are some good products that help with large pores. Depending on how sensitive your skin is, can determine which percentage works for you. A bha/aha (abh) cleanser is good also. Sally's Beauty Supply has their own abh line called beyond belief. This includes a foaming cleaner. I have big pores and although nothing will make them disappear, they aren't as noticeable when they're clean.
